The M&A Advisory team, part of KPMG’s Deals & Strategy practice, aims to advise clients on potential sales, mergers and acquisitions of companies. The team supports clients throughout the various phases of an M&A transaction and contributes from the very early stages, during which a client (corporate or private shareholder) considers the strategic path forward, through to the final phase, supporting the signing and closing of an agreement.
